Pavilion all in one
It makes a series of 3 beeps then 4 beeps and then pops up that there is an unsupported adapter installed and shuts back down will not go to the startup menu.

Found a fix:
Unplug the power cord from the monitor, wait a few minutes and plug it back in.

What the problem is, I have no idea but it was very frusterating. Hope that works for all cases
